Southern University Athletic Foundation officially announced that they will be launching a new rugby program at Southern University of Baton Rouge. The press release stated that this program will be raising funds to not only support operations but also allow accepting funds for individuals interested in creating active scholarships for players.
The Director of Rugby and head coach for Southern University Rugby program will be led by Army veteran and former Arkansas State rugby player, Isaiah Washington.

Southern University is one of the oldest historically black colleges and universities in the country at 147 years old. It is well known for its academic excellence and innovation, as well as its high-level athletic program. The Southern University Marching Band, also known as the “The Human Jukebox”, is one of the most recognized collegiate bands in the country.
